Weird HDMI Problem (Sharp Aquos, LCD42D62U)

I've owned a Sharp Aquos 42 inch LCD TV for approximately a year and a half now. Within the last 7 months or so, I've encountered a weird problem on an occasional basis, where my TV will not give me any sound through HDMI Input #1 (which is the fourth input on the TV.) It's the input that I use for my XBOX 360. Sometimes, I'll turn the console on and I won't have any sound (only video) and it'll fix itself within a couple of hours if I turn it off and go do something else for a while. Other times, the sound will be working, but it'll disappear if I turn the TV off for a second (I hate leaving my TV on when I leave the room for a few minutes.)

I'm not sure if it's the TV or the cord, but I'm thinking about trying to return the TV as a precautionary measure. The reason being is that I don't have any extra HDMI cables that I can try out and Microsoft wants me to ship my HDMI cable away to them before they'll send me a replacement and I'd like to not be without one for a while. I just sent my XBOX away and they wouldn't allow me to send the cable with it.

Has anyone heard of this problem? I'm worried that it might be the TV because it only happens occasionally and it sometimes only happens when I turn the TV on or off. I'm considering calling the store I bought the TV from today, since I paid for a four year warranty.
